Group by Employee Code

This example explains how to group the Employee Super Funds grid by Employee Code to check employees who are attached to multiple superannuation funds.

  1. In the Employee Super Funds | View Grid Layouts tab, click your customised layout name and then press Ctrl+Q to activate it.
  2. In the Employee Super Funds | View Entities tab, drag-and-drop the Employee Code header into the grouping area.
  3. Click the Full Expand button Embedded GIF File 0% Template to see all records.
  4. Press Ctrl+E and save the report as an Excel file.

Employees could have multiple active Employee Super Funds because they are making employee contributions to other superannuation funds or changing superannuation funds in the current pay period.
